AI-generated source summary

The analysis focuses on NVIDIA's stock performance following its earnings report. Despite beating earnings expectations by 85% for revenue and $4 billion for outlook, the stock experienced a pullback. The video highlights past instances where NVIDIA's stock dropped after earnings announcements, citing a pattern of overreactions to positive news. For instance, after the February earnings, the stock fell 5.34% in two days, and in August, it dropped 10.42% in two days, followed by a further 15.52% decline over a month. These past movements suggest a potential for downside after strong earnings. The current analysis suggests that while NVIDIA has shown strong growth, recent price action indicates potential consolidation or a short-term pullback. The speaker notes that despite positive earnings, the stock's reaction might be muted or even negative due to overall market sentiment and the stock's already high valuation. The expectation is that the stock might see a slight correction before continuing its upward trend, with a target of $250 if the current bullish momentum persists, but a break below $210 would invalidate the bullish outlook.
